Medical Malpractice
A medical malpractice claim in birth injury cases involves showing that the doctor or hospital, or any other health care provider committed negligent actions. These actions could cause harm to the mother or the baby during the labor and delivery process, with often life-altering results. These claims require a detailed review of medical records, and the assistance from experts in the field to determine if the defendant's conduct was below the standard of their field. They are typically physicians, nurses, doctors' assistants, therapists, or psychologists who have a thorough knowledge of the field and are acquainted with the appropriate standards of care for their specialization.
Your attorney will begin by obtaining medical records from the doctor or other health care providers who were involved in your child's birth. These records are crucial to finding the direct connection between your child's injuries and health care you gave them. Your lawyer will collaborate with other pediatricians and obstetricians and financial experts to create a solid case.
The next step is to request the defendant health care provider's employment and disciplinary record. These documents may reveal information about complaints made against the defendant medical professional and could reveal an unsatisfactory or irregular treatment.

Statute of limitations
The time period within the period within which a claim for medical negligence must be filed depends on the state and type of lawsuit. These laws are intended to make sure that cases can be brought while physical evidence and witness memories are fresh. As a result, claims filed after a time limit has passed are typically dismissed.
A birth injury lawyer will consult with one or more experts medical witnesses to demonstrate how a healthcare provider's actions or inaction led to your child's injuries. Experts can often establish the standard of medical care that an identical professional in the exact same field would have given under the same or similar circumstances.
